A KAYAK and an inflatable boat have been stolen from a sea scout club in Clifton.

Leaders at the 1st Clifton (York) Sea Scouts discovered the garage where they keep boats and equipment, off Green Lane, had been broken into in the early hours of Wednesday morning.

Scout leader Peter Ingham said the break in happened at about 12.45am according to CCTV covering the site.

He said members of the group arrived the next morning to find the garage door, which had been bolted, was pulled off its hinges and an orange Pyranha Inazone kayak, worth about £400, and a grey Quicksilver inflatable boat, worth up to £1,500, had been taken.

Paul said: "It's very frustrating, just the fact that somebody would steal from kids, because that's what they are doing. We will still be able to go out but it restricts what we can do."

The club, which has members between the ages of 10 and 18, is appealing for anyone with information about the incident to get in touch.

North Yorkshire Police are investigating.
